The GREAT Morning Revolution Bible Study Guide plus Streaming Video: Discover a Rhythm of Prayer to Begin Each Day

Rate this book
From skepticism to sunrise, your journey to early mornings can transform your days. What was once a struggle is now my 'Great Morning'—a time for Gratitude, Reflection, Exaltation, Ask, and Trust. In the quiet dawn, I found a sanctuary where gratitude and supplication blend, where my soul finds its rhythm in conversation with God. Find in the dawn a promise of spiritual awakening and the extraordinary in the ordinary act of rising early. Join Tara Beth in discovering the serenity of a GREAT Morning.

The practice of waking early to seek God's presence is woven into the fabric of God's Word, tracing its roots through the stories of prophets, kings, and ordinary individuals who found solace, guidance, and strength in the morning light. It is a practice that transcends cultural and temporal boundaries, uniting generations of believers in a shared pursuit of spiritual awakening.


In this six-session video Bible study, she delves into the scriptures, uncovers the significance of the morning watch—the time when the world transitions from darkness to light—and Tara explores the transformative power of aligning our first waking thoughts with God. From the Gospels to the Psalms, from the wisdom literature to the historical narratives, the Bible resounds with the call to seek God early, to set the tone of our day with prayer, and to surrender the unfolding hours to His presence.


To those who scoff at the idea of being morning people, she extends an embrace the challenge, not as a forced routine but as an opportunity for communion. The dawn holds a promise—a promise of self-discovery, of spiritual awakening, and of encountering the extraordinary in the ordinary act of rising early for morning prayer.

About the author

Tara Beth Leach

21 books31 followers
Tara Beth Leach is senior pastor of First Church of the Nazarene of Pasadena in Southern California. She is a graduate of Olivet Nazarene University (BA, youth ministry) and Northern Theological Seminary (MDiv). She is a regular writer for Missio Alliance and has contributed to other publications such as Christianity Today, Christian Week, The Jesus Creed, The Table Magazine, Reflecting the Image Devotional, Renovating Holiness, and most recently a chapter in The Apostle Paul and the Christian Life. She has two beautiful and rambunctious sons, and has been married to the love of her life, Jeff, since 2006.
